How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Roosevelt?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Roosevelt Studio Apartments | $881 | $700 | $1,265 |
| Roosevelt 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,150 | $650 | $2,795 |
| Roosevelt 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,518 | $750 | $2,494 |
| Roosevelt 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,654 | $1,150 | $2,872 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Roosevelt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Studio Roosevelt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Roosevelt is $881.
What is the largest available Studio Roosevelt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Roosevelt is a 581 square feet unit starting from $1,075 at The Deneau.
What is the average size for Roosevelt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Roosevelt is currently 547 sq ft.
